MKFIFO(1) BSD General Commands Manual MKFIFO(1)

NAME

mmkkffiiffoo - make fifos

SYNOPSIS

mmkkffiiffoo [-mm mode] fifoname ...

DESCRIPTION

mmkkffiiffoo creates the fifos requested, in the order specified, using mode 0666 modified by the current umask(2). The options are as follows:

-mm Set the file permission bits of newly-created directories to

mode. The mode is specified as in chmod(1). In symbolic mode

strings, the ``+'' and ``-'' operators are interpreted relative

to an assumed initial mode of ``a=rw'' mmkkffiiffoo requires write permission in the parent directory. mmkkffiiffoo exits 0 if successful, and >0 if an error occurred.

STANDARDS

The mmkkffiiffoo utility is expected to be IEEE Std 1003.2-1992 (``POSIX.2'')

compliant. HISTORY mmkkffiiffoo command appeared in 4.4BSD. 4.4BSD January 5, 1994 4.4BSD
